Privacy & threat intelligence data determines if an IP address is likely to be a VPN, proxy, or Tor exit node, or is a known spammer or abuser.

This data is sourced from a combination of public databases and our own proprietary detection systems.

An Autonomous System Number (ASN) is a unique identifier assigned to a network or a collection of networks that are all managed, controlled, and supervised by a single entity or organization.

ASN and abuse contact data — used to report malicious activity — comes from Regional Internet Registries (RIRs).
